Transaction 88ab43c7883d5de08ef8dddb1970d2005e1033fdd41992a79bb309a4b7eac8bd
4 Input
2 Outputs
- 88ab43c7883d5de08ef8dddb1970d2005e1033fdd41992a79bb309a4b7eac8bd:0
- 88ab43c7883d5de08ef8dddb1970d2005e1033fdd41992a79bb309a4b7eac8bd:1
value 5070539
address 15rndti9teJv8781zY4LAdx9YqSnJTssWf
value 1021237
address 1623VTkMZx9pFQ5SSkdq25GmsStF8XNxok